Overview

Features

  • MultiCore technology
  • Reading of printed and directly marked 1D and 2D codes
  • Working Range: ≥ 20 mm
  • Resolution: 736 × 480 Pixel
  • Resolution: 0.35 MP
  • Focal distance: 6.4 mm
  • Image Chip: monochrome
  • Image chip size: 1/3"
  • Pixel Size: 6 × 6 µm
  • Light Source: White Light
  • Optics: Auto-focus
  • Visual Field: see table 1
  • min. Resolution: 0.1 mm
  • Barcode Printing Contrast: > 15 %
  • Minimum object distance: 20 mm
  • Temperature Range: -13°F to 131°F*
  • Atmospheric humidity: 5 to 95%, non-condensing
  • Supply Voltage: 18 to 30 V DC
  • Current Consumption (Ub = 24 V): < 200 mA
  • Scan Rate: 20 scans/sec
  • Inputs/Outputs: 6
  • Switching Output Voltage Drop: < 2.5 V
  • Switching Output/Switching Current: 100 mA
  • Short Circuit Protection: yes
  • Reverse Polarity Protection: yes
  • Interface: RS-232/Ethernet
  • Protection Class: III
  • Setting Method: Web server
  • Housing Material: Aluminum, anodised
  • Degree of Protection: IP67
  • UL Enclosure Type: 1
  • Connection: M12 × 1; 12-pin
  • Type of Connection Ethernet: M12 × 1; 8-pin, X-cod.
  • Optic Cover: Plastic, PMMA
  • PWIS-free: yes
  • Weight: 302 g
  • MTTFd (EN ISO 13849-1): 227.7 a
  • License package: weQubeDecode
  • 1D and 2D code reading: yes
  • PNP NO: yes
  • Illumination Output: yes
  • RS-232 Interface: yes
  • Ethernet: yes
  • Output: Push-pull, NPN, PNP
  • Circuit: NC, NC/NO, NO
  • Working Distance: 20 mm, 100 mm, 200 mm
  • Visual Field: 9 × 6 mm, 65 × 42 mm, 134 × 87 mm

Description

The scanner weQubeDecode is based on the wenglor MultiCore technology. Omnidirectional scanning enables decoding of printed, needle-punched, laser-engraved or etched codes on various materials in any orientation. Good scanning results are even obtained with poor code quality. In addition to the established 1D codes it is also suitable for scanning various 2D codes. A list of readable code types is found in the operating instructions.
